A devoutly religious man with an unrelenting disdain for Yankees, Daniel Harvey Hill was among the fiercest warriors to ever stride a battlefield.

About the author










A graduate of the University of North Carolina at Chapel Hill, Chris J. Hartley is the author of several magazine articles and three books: The Lost Soldier: The Ordeal of a World War II GI From the Home Front to the Huertgen Forest; Stoneman's Raid, 1865; and Stuart's Tarheels: James B. Gordon and His North Carolina Cavalry. His writing has garnered several awards, including the Willie Parker Peace Prize from the North Carolina Society of Historians and a Preservation Education and Publication Award from The Historic Salisbury Foundation. Hartley is a frequent speaker and battlefield tour guide. He and his wife Laurie have two daughters and reside in Pfafftown, North Carolina.
